Both follow a group of high school best friends who are impacted by a tragedy. Through past (high school) and present (adult) timelines, a supernatural "time-slip" reunites them as they try to fix the past and prevent their biggest regrets.
Additionally, both are set in Nagano Prefecture: Orange in Matsumoto and Boku Dake ga 17-sai no Sekai de in and around Lake Suwa.
Plus, Yamazaki Kento appears in both (but just a guest role in 17-sai)!

These two TBS dramas are definitely cousins!
Both are slice-of-life dramas that address the modern malaise of trying to find your place in a world where you don't quite fit in, all while navigating the ups and downs of love and life.
In both dramas, the female lead is a quirky young woman who often over-thinks and over-analyzes situations, which sometimes puts her at odds with other characters/society. Unsatisfied with her career, she decides to make a major life change early in the drama. Both are “everyone has their own story” kind of dramas where even the most minor character is important.
